Called “Wi-Fi 6E”, this newly upgraded network standard is designed to take advantage of the 6GHz band, which has not been licensed yet. What does this mean?

Network devices are becoming more and more popular. From connected smart screens to network door locks, every smart device we equip our homes consumes bandwidth and makes home Wi-Fi networks potentially congested. . Wi-Fi 6E is designed to solve this problem.

Since the 5GHz band has been in use for quite some time, and we are increasingly “squeezing” the performance of this frequency band, people are starting to propose that it is time to open the frequency band. 6GHz for previously unlicensed activities. This frequency range is currently used only by devices such as radars. Wi-Fi 6E will open 14 more 80MHz channels and 7 more 160MHz channels, thereby increasing the amount of bandwidth needed to address the growing bandwidth shortage.

For consumers, Wi-Fi 6E appears to mean that we can stream high quality videos at up to 8K resolution faster, with less interruption, and sufficient throughput and reduced capacity. latency when using AR / VR applications. You will also be able to add more networking devices to your home network without worrying about slowing things down.

The Wi-Fi Alliance expects smartphones and home access points to be the first devices to adopt new technology. Of course, Wi-Fi 6E still needs to pass a few evaluations from regulatory agencies, and it could take several months to a year before we start seeing the first devices that support it.
